Church Bulletin Bloopers:
“Ladies, don’t forget the rummage sale. It’s a chance to get rid of those things not worth keeping around the house. Don’t forget your husbands.”
The sermon this morning: “Jesus Walks on the Water”
The sermon tonight “Searching for Jesus”
Irving Benson and Jessie Carter were married on October 24 in the church. So ends a friendship
that began in their school days.
For those of you who have children and don’t know it, we have a nursery downstairs.
The ladies of the Church have cast off clothing of every kind. They may be seen in the basement
on Friday afternoon.
The eighth-graders will be presenting Shakespeare’s Hamlet in the Church basement Friday at 7 PM. The Congregation is invited to attend this tragedy.
The Associate Minister unveiled the church’s new tithing campaign slogan last Sunday:
“I Upped My Pledge – Up Yours.”
